KEYLESS ACCESS SYSTEMF
REMOTE KEYLESS ENTRY TRANSMITTER (KEY FOB)F
The Keyless Access System enables operation of the doors and tailgate without  
removing the Remote Keyless Entry (RKE) transmitter from your pocket or purse. The transmitter must be within 3 feet of the tailgate or the door being unlocked. 
KEYLESS UNLOCKING 
With the transmitter within range: 
 Press the button on the driver’s door handle to unlock the driver’s door; press it again within 5 seconds to unlock all doors and tailgate. 
 Press the button on a passenger door handle to unlock all doors and tailgate. 
 Press the lower button on the tailgate to lower the standard tailgate. 
KEYLESS LOCKING 
With the ignition off, the transmitter removed from the vehicle, and all doors closed: 
 Press the button on any door handle to lock all doors and tailgate immediately. 
 If Passive Locking is turned on, all doors will lock automatically after a short delay. 
Note: To change the door lock and unlock settings, go to Settings > Vehicle > Remote Lock, Unlock, Start.See Keys, Doors and Windows in your Owner’s Manual.
 Lock  
Press to lock all doors and  tailgate.
 Unlock
Press to unlock the driver’s door.
Press again to unlock all doors and tailgate.
Press and hold until the win-dows are fully open.F To enable, go to Settings > Vehicle > Remote Lock, Unlock, Start.
Press and hold the Lock/Unlock button for 1 second to fold/unfold the power mirrors.F To enable, go to Settings > Vehicle > Comfort and Convenience.
 Power Release TailgateF 
Press twice to lower the tailgate.  
 Vehicle Locator/Panic Alarm
Press and release to locate your vehicle. The exterior lamps flash and the horn chirps 3 times.
Press and hold to activate the alarm. Press again to cancel the alarm. 
 Remote Vehicle StartF
Press and release the  Lock button and then press and hold the  button until the turn  
signal lamps flash to start the engine from outside the vehicle. After entering the vehicle, turn on the ignition. 
To cancel a remote start, press and hold the  button until the parking lamps turn off.

 To apply the parking brake, press the 
 Parking Brake button on the left side of the instrument panel.
 To release the parking brake, turn on the ignition, press the brake pedal, and then press the  button.

The tailgate has 6 functional positions to improve loading, unloading and access to the cargo box.
1. Primary Gate
  Open the primary gate for access to the cargo box.
2. Primary Gate Load Stop
 With the primary gate open, the load stop helps keep longer items secure in the cargo box.
3. Easy Access
 The inner gate folds down for easier reach into the cargo box to access items near the cab.
4. Full-width Step
 With the primary gate open, the inner gate folds into a sturdy step (up to 375 lbs.) with a conve-nient handle for easy cargo box entry and exit. 
5. Inner Gate Load Stop
 With the primary gate closed, fold the inner gate for two-tier storage and open the load stop to help keep longer items secure.
6. Inner Gate Work Surface
 With the primary gate closed, fold the inner gate for two-tier storage or for use as a standing-height work surface.
Note: Do not lower the inner gate with the primary gate open if a hitch ball or trailer is attached. 
OPEN THE INNER GATE
 Press the upper button (A) on the tailgate. 
OPEN THE PRIMARY GATE
 Press the lower button (B) on the tailgate. 
 Press the Power Tailgate button twice on the Remote Keyless Entry transmitter. 
 Press the Power Tailgate button on the  
center of the instrument panel. 
OPEN THE PRIMARY  GATE AND INNER GATE 
 Press the lower button and then upper button (B then A) on the tail-gate consecutively.
OPEN THE LOAD STOP  OR STEP
 Press the release bar (C).
